I use PT SL on my racing wheels and PT Pro on my everyday wheels and sharkfin sensors on the bikes. I have seen very few dropouts with either the SL or the Pro model. Did you follow the newer sharkfin mounting recommendations of < 3 inches from axle to sensor rather than the older 5 inch mounting recommendation?

Assuming you've changed the CPU battery as well as hub, and your receiver is right up close to the hub (per installation spec), call Cycle-Ops customer support.
They don't always get it right the first time (the hubs working 100% when shipped), but they make up for it by fixing them quickly, for free.
